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ients of low back pain as a primary complaint for more than 12 weeks. 2. No radiation of low back pain to other region. 3. Clinically and radiologically diagnosed patients of Waja-uz-zahar (Non specific low back pain) 4. Patients who agreed to sign the informed consent and follow the protocol. 5. No allergy to Hulba, Katan, Roghan-e-babuna. 6. No apparent spine deformity like kyphosis, scoliosis, lordosis etc. 7. Willingness to participate in the study.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ients below the age 18 years and above 50 years. 2. Any systemic illness such as Liver, Kidney, Cardiac disorders, Diabetes mellitus, Hypertension, Osteomylitis, Tuberculosis. 3. Spinal deformity (Congenital / Acquired), Paget’s disease, Pot’s spine, Spinal tumor and Cancer. 4. Previous history of Trauma, Fracture or Surgery of lumbosacral region. 5. Having evidence of infection on the skin over the lumbosacral region. 6. On contraceptive / Steroid and Analgesic therapy. 7. Patients who do not report for follow up and who refuses to join the study. 8. Pregnant women. 9. A systemic or local allergic reaction to Hulba, Katan, Kunjud and Babuna. 10. Impaired sensation. 11. Implantation of prosthesis.
